Book Review: Survivor by Chuck Palahniuk

SurvivorSurvivor by Chuck Palahniuk




Favorite Quote: "The craving inside of me is to be clutched at by some dead girl. To put my ear to her chest and be hearing nothing. Even getting munched on by zombies beats the idea that I'm only flesh and blood, skin and bone. Demon or angel or evil spirit, I just need something to show itself. Ghoulie or ghosty or long-legged beastie, I just want my hand held."






This book starts on a plane that's going down. . .













That's definetly not a bad way to start.
However when I ended this book I was like. . .huh?










And truthfully throughout the book it was just unusally odd and entertaining. It's just like looking at this:















Like watching this banana booger guy, you can't look away. You want to know what happens, but has your life improved from checking it out? I don't quite know. I mean. . . I do love bananas.


The rating for this book is difficult cause sometimes I was like OH MY GOD HE IS A GENIUS!


Other times I was like.........Say What?













Therefore I will give it a strong 3 stars and reccommend this to readers who like a dark gritty edge to their literary fiction BUT are able to forgive things that you don't understand.
